    Summary
    Enables identical protein binding activity. Acts upstream of or within myelination and sensory perception of sound. Located in myelin sheath. Is expressed in brain; sciatic nerve; and spinal cord. Orthologous to human GJC3 (gap junction protein gamma 3). [provided by Alliance of Genome Resources, Apr 2022]
